Those controls on a proxy are to protect against the careless and the clueless. No competent security team will rely on them to prevent ingress/egress of data or malicious code by skilled individuals.



Correct - this is an attack on the other side of the airtight hatchway (i.e., you must persuade the user to run wget in a certain fashion and run the resulting exe, and if you don't need to persuade the user you could have done something simpler).
